How Our Wall Water Damage Repair Service Works
With wall water damage repair,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a strict process to ensure that your home is restored quickly and efficiently.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and developing a customized plan to address the issue.
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of experts to your home to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. This will help us develop a customized plan to address the issue and prevent further damage.
Removal of Standing Water
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any standing water from your walls, ensuring that your home is safe and dry.
Demolition and Removal of Damaged Materials
We’ll carefully remove any damaged materials, including drywall, insulation, and flooring, to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ough restoration.
Dehumidification and Drying
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your walls and ensure that your home is completely dry.
Repair and Reconstruction
Once the damage has been assessed and the necessary repairs have been made, our team will reconstruct your walls to their original condition, using only the highest-quality materials and techniques.

Warning Signs You Need Wall Water Damage Repair
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. That’s why it’s essential to be aware of the following warning signs and take action quickly: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ent odor,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
Warped or buckled drywall can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any irregularities in your drywall,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any peeling pa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age can be a sign of a more extensive issue. If you notice any visible water damage,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els can lead to mold and mildew growth. If you notice high hum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Wall Water Damage Repair Cost in Barnstable, MA
The cost of wall water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Barnstable, MA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Removal of standing water |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of standing water, complexity of removal |
| Demolition and removal of damaged materials | $2,000 – $10,000 | Amount of damaged materials, complexity of removal |
| Dehumidification and drying | $1,500 – $6,000 | Amount of moisture, complexity of drying |
| Repair and reconstruction | $3,000 – $15,000 | Severity of damage, complexity of repairs |
